To measure the speakers' size, set the speaker upright, so the widest part of the cone is facing up. Then, use a ruler or tape and measure at the widest point of the speaker from one edge of the mounting frame to the other. If the speakers are not circular but oval, take several measurements around the speakers.

How to Measure Speaker Size and How We Determine Car Speaker Sizes for the Best Fit

Speaker size is typically measured by its diameter, which can range from as small as 1 inch to over 18 inches. However, it's important to note that the actual dimensions of speakers can vary based on a manufacturer's design, so a 6.5-inch speaker may not actually be exactly 6.5 inches in diameter.

How to Measure Car Speakers Size?

What size speakers are in my car? Figuring out car speaker sizes can be a little confusing. In the mobile audio world, it helps to think about the size of car speakers as more of a category than an actual size. Much like a 2x4 is not actually 2" thick and 4" wide, a 6-1/2" speaker isn't actually 6-1/2" in diameter.
